On the April 22, 2020 Episode of /Film Daily, Film editor-in-chief Peter Sciretta is joined by /Film senior writer Ben Pearson, and writers Hoai-Tran Bui and Chris Evangelista to discuss the latest film and tv news, including Westworld, The Hunger Games, Venom 2, HBO Max, Scoob!, SXSW and more. In The News: Chris: ‘Westworld’ Season 4 is Official at HBO, Showrunners Planning a Six Season Run HT: ‘The Hunger Games’ Prequel Movie Officially Coming From Lionsgate, Francis Lawrence Returning to Direct Ben (og Jacob): ‘Venom 2’ is Now Titled ‘Venom: Let There Be Carnage’ – And Has Been Delayed Eight Months HT: HBO Max Streaming Service Sets Official Launch Date for May 27HBO Max Originals Trailers: Anna Kendrick’s ‘Love Life,’ Sundance Documentary ‘On the Record,’ New ‘Looney Tunes Cartoons,’ and More Ben: Warner Media “Rethinking the Theatrical Model”Chris: ‘Scoob!’ Skipping Theaters and Going Directly to Digital Ben: 'Spaceship Earth' Trailer: Neon's Biosphere Documentary Has an Innovative Release Strategy HT: SXSW Filmmakers Aren’t On Board with Amazon’s Offer to Screen Their Movies for Free Chris: The Majority of Georgia Movie Theaters Won’t Reopen Next Week All the other stuff you need to know: You can find more about all the stories we mentioned on today’s show at slashfilm.com, and linked inside the show notes. /Film Daily is published every weekday, bringing you the most exciting news from the world of movies and television as well as deeper dives into the great features from slashfilm.com.
